Car Crash Texas Today in Texas: On June 19, a driver in a Tesla Model 3 using an automated driving assistance system (autopilot) failed to remain in its lane and veered into a Texas home at high speed, killing a 76-year-old female resident. The driver showed no signs of drug or alcohol impairment, according to Harris County Sheriff's authorities. It was not yet confirmed whether the driver attempted to brake or disengage the autopilot before the crash.
